Sub-major - Historical and Contemporary Employment Relations

Western Sydney University Sub-major Code: S08HCER.1


This sub-major is available to advanced students completing the Human Resource and Industrial Relations Key Program who achieve a grade point average of at least 5.0. It is seen as preparation for an honours year. This sub-major was developed to provide students with a more in-depth analysis of the employment relations area, providing them with a sound basis of knowledge from which to undertake postgraduate studies. This sub-major explores historical and contemporary issues and debates in the employment relations field.
